Presents a report which seeks to discuss the concept of disadvantaged and the issues related to its measurement, the implications of the theory of economic integration for dislocation of economies, sectors and regions; the various measures which have been used to ameliorate the negative effects of economic integration internationally; and the measures used in Caricom to achieve the same end.
